Manusmriti's Stance on Charity The reel accurately conveys the teachings of Manusmriti, specifically verse 11.10, which advises against giving charity when one's own family is not adequately provided for. It emphasizes that such actions can lead to a man's downfall and unhappiness, even after death.
Supporting Texts and Principles The reel also correctly cites Jaimini and Parashar on the nature and efficacy of charity. Jaimini's principle that charity driven by arrogance or greed is fruitless is accurately presented.
Parashar's classification of charity based on how it is given (to a visitor, by invitation, or through service) is also correctly stated. Overall Accuracy The reel's claims are well-supported by the cited scriptures and principles, making its message factually accurate according to the referenced texts.
